The musical originally premiered in December 2014 at the West End and turned out be an instant success by winning two Olivier Awards, one for Best Actress in a Musical and the other for Best Choreography. Since the audience cannot get enough of the incredible musical, Mary Poppins is currently running again at London’s Prince Edward Theatre.
Disney and Cameron Mackintosh’s multi award winning musical is an absolute joy for the spectators and a favourite choice for schools and community theatres. Oscar winning screen writer and Downton Abbey creator, Julian Fellows’ book compliments the original stories and the famous film to bring unique stage creation. The music and lyrics of the show are by the Sherman Brothers with additional music by George Stiles and Anthony Drewe. The enchanting tale of the beloved Nanny of everyone is brilliantly presented on stage with memorable songs, mesmerising effects and sensational choreography. Many popular songs from the 1964 film are also included in the musical, some of which are, “A Spoonful of Sugar”, ”Chim Chim Cher-ee”, “Let's Go Fly a Kite”, “Step in Time”, “Practically Perfect”, “The Perfect Nanny”, “A Man Has Dreams”, “Playing the Game”, “Jolly Holiday”, “Supercalifragilisticexpialidocious” and “Feed the Birds”.
Mary Poppins is directed by Richard Eyre and co-directed/choreographed by Sir Matthew Bourne OBE while Stephen Mear is the co-choreographer. Sound design is by Paul Gatehouse, orchestrations by William David Brohn, scene and costume design by Bob Crowley and lighting design by Natasha Katz and Hugh Vanstone.
